1. Preheat oven to 400 F.
2. Add oil to large, heavy skillet. Heat oil over medium-high heat.
3. Add salmon to hot oil. Sear 1 minute on each side.
4. Transfer salmon to glass baking dish.
5. Drizzle with soy sauce and white wine.
6. Bake salmon 10 minutes, or until cooked through.
7. While salmon bakes, add orange juice, orange zest, dry sherry, and fresh ginger to saucepan.
8. Simmer 15 minutes over low heat, or until sauce is reduced by half and thickened.
9. Add orange slices. Cook 15 seconds. Remove from stovetop.
To Serve:
1. Arrange salmon on individual plates.
2. Drizzle salmon with sauce. Serve hot.
